[gnome-sudoku/vala-port: 87/87] Merge branch 'master' into vala-port
- From: Michael Catanzaro <mcatanzaro src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-sudoku/vala-port: 87/87] Merge branch 'master' into vala-port
- Date: Sat, 16 Nov 2013 22:48:03 +0000 (UTC)
commit a2fe1cd57aa0b299b6af427cfd4ea2f40531273a
Merge: 5cf8280 164ae0d
Author: Michael Catanzaro <mcatanzaro gnome org>
Date: Sat Nov 16 16:47:29 2013 -0600
Merge branch 'master' into vala-port
Conflicts:
configure.ac
data/gnome-sudoku.desktop.in
data/select_game.ui
src/gnome-sudoku
src/lib/Makefile.am
src/lib/dancer.py
src/lib/defaults.py
src/lib/dialog_swallower.py
src/lib/game_selector.py
src/lib/gnome_sudoku.py
src/lib/gsudoku.py
src/lib/gtk_goodies/Makefile.am
src/lib/gtk_goodies/Undo.py
src/lib/gtk_goodies/dialog_extras.py
src/lib/main.py
src/lib/number_box.py
src/lib/pausable.py
src/lib/printing.py
src/lib/saver.py
src/lib/simple_debug.py
src/lib/sudoku.py
src/lib/sudoku_maker.py
src/lib/tracker_info.py
COPYING | 41 +-
Makefile.am | 5 +
NEWS | 48 +
configure.ac | 11 +-
data/Makefile.am | 28 +-
data/gnome-sudoku.appdata.xml.in | 30 +
data/gnome-sudoku.desktop.in | 10 +
data/gnome-sudoku.desktop.in.in | 14 -
data/icons/HighContrast/Makefile.am | 6 +-
data/icons/HighContrast/scalable/gnome-sudoku.svg | 74 -
data/icons/Makefile.am | 2 +
data/icons/hicolor/Makefile.am | 2 +
...a.xml.in => org.gnome.gnome-sudoku.gschema.xml} | 4 +-
git.mk | 167 +-
gnome-sudoku.doap | 7 +
help/cs/cs.po | 2001 ++++---
help/fr/fr.po | 49 +-
po/POTFILES.in | 5 +-
po/be.po | 25 +-
po/ca.po | 2853 +--------
po/ca valencia po | 2935 +--------
po/cs.po | 30 +-
po/da.po | 27 +-
po/de.po | 37 +-
po/el.po | 158 +-
po/es.po | 142 +-
po/et.po | 16 +-
po/eu.po | 31 +-
po/fi.po | 7129 ++++++++------------
po/fr.po | 22 +-
po/gl.po | 22 +-
po/he.po | 270 +-
po/hu.po | 41 +-
po/id.po | 30 +-
po/it.po | 23 +-
po/ja.po | 24 +-
po/ko.po | 27 +-
po/lt.po | 28 +-
po/lv.po | 29 +-
po/ml.po | 452 +-
po/nb.po | 24 +-
po/pl.po | 29 +-
po/pt.po | 29 +-
po/pt_BR.po | 35 +-
po/ru.po | 4885 +-------------
po/sk.po | 168 +-
po/sl.po | 111 +-
po/sr.po | 28 +-
po/sr latin po | 28 +-
po/zh_HK.po | 37 +-
po/zh_TW.po | 37 +-
51 files changed, 5637 insertions(+), 16629 deletions(-)
---
diff --cc configure.ac
index c6319a6,2f93486..6797c50
--- a/configure.ac
+++ b/configure.ac
@@@ -13,21 -12,16 +13,24 @@@ dnl ###################################
dnl Dependencies
dnl ###########################################################################
-PYGOBJECT_REQUIRED=2.28.3
+GTK_REQUIRED=3.4.0
-PKG_CHECK_MODULES(PYGOBJECT, [
- pygobject-3.0 >= $PYGOBJECT_REQUIRED
+PKG_CHECK_MODULES(GNOME_SUDOKU, [
+ gio-2.0
+ gtk+-3.0 >= $GTK_REQUIRED
+ gee-1.0
])
+ AC_PATH_PROG([APPDATA_VALIDATE], [appdata-validate], [/bin/true])
+ AC_PATH_PROG([DESKTOP_FILE_VALIDATE], [desktop-file-validate], [/bin/true])
+
dnl ###########################################################################
+dnl GResources
+dnl ###########################################################################
+
+AC_PATH_PROG(GLIB_COMPILE_RESOURCES, glib-compile-resources)
+
+dnl ###########################################################################
dnl Internationalization
dnl ###########################################################################
@@@ -51,8 -45,10 +54,8 @@@ data/Makefil
data/icons/Makefile
data/icons/hicolor/Makefile
data/icons/HighContrast/Makefile
- data/gnome-sudoku.desktop.in
help/Makefile
src/Makefile
-src/lib/Makefile
-src/lib/defs.py
-src/lib/gtk_goodies/Makefile
+src/gnome-sudoku.gresource.xml
])
+ AC_OUTPUT
diff --cc data/gnome-sudoku.desktop.in
index 0000000,4adda84..aabb34d
mode 000000,100644..100644
--- a/data/gnome-sudoku.desktop.in
+++ b/data/gnome-sudoku.desktop.in
@@@ -1,0 -1,11 +1,10 @@@
+ [Desktop Entry]
+ _Name=Sudoku
+ _Comment=Test your logic skills in this number grid puzzle
-_Keywords=game;board;tiles;japanese;
+ Exec=gnome-sudoku
+ Icon=gnome-sudoku
+ Terminal=false
+ Type=Application
+ Categories=GNOME;GTK;Game;LogicGame;
+ StartupNotify=true
+ Version=1.0
diff --cc data/org.gnome.gnome-sudoku.gschema.xml
index fb22252,61c58ce..c93c203
--- a/data/org.gnome.gnome-sudoku.gschema.xml
+++ b/data/org.gnome.gnome-sudoku.gschema.xml
@@@ -101,10 -101,5 +101,10 @@@
<summary>Number of puzzles to print on a page</summary>
<description>Number of puzzles to print on a page</description>
</key>
+ <key name="fullscreen" type="b">
+ <default>false</default>
- <_summary>A flag to enable fullscreen mode</_summary>
- <_description>A flag to enable fullscreen mode</_description>
++ <summary>A flag to enable fullscreen mode</summary>
++ <description>A flag to enable fullscreen mode</description>
+ </key>
</schema>
</schemalist>
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]